基于MATLAB的二维探地雷达三维成像方法与设计方案

本技术公开了一种基于MATLAB的二维探地雷达三维成像方法,包括以下步骤:S1、对二维探地雷达进行组装和调试;S2、对采集路线中的各条车道进行数据采集;S3、三维成像模型建立;S4、对三维成像模型进行外观优化和尺寸调整;S5、三维数据导出;S6、数据格式转换;S7、三维反射电压数据模拟;S8、对最大及最小值的颜进行设定;S9、将三维数据导入三维成像模型,得到三维成像;S10、对异常位置进行切片化显示,直观地显示出道路深层病害。本技术通过三维模型的建立与优化,形成能够容纳三维雷达数据的成像模型,在将模拟的三维数据导入后,实现三维雷达成像,并具备图像切割功能,以便观察道路内部异常图像。
权利要求书
1.一种基于MATLAB的二维探地雷达三维成像方法,其特征在于,该方法包括以下步骤:
S1、准备工作:对二维探地雷达进行组装和调试,将其安装在雷达车上,确认进行数据采集的路段和采集时间,并制定数据采集计划;
S2、数据采集:通过雷达车按照采集计划中的采集路线,对采集路线中的各条车道进行数据采集,为让雷达车按直线行驶,在采集左轮迹带时,将左轮轧在车道左标线上;在采集右轮迹带时,将右轮轧在车道右标线上;通过二维探地雷达配套数据处理软件Pavecheck对数据进行数据完整性检查;
S3、三维成像模型建立:通过生成超立方体定义域中的数据点矩阵的方法,在MATLAB中建立用于存储三维数据的三维矩阵,作为三维成像模型;S4、模型优化:对三维成像模型进行外观优化和尺寸调整,使其符合道路外形;
S5、三维数据导出:通过二维探地雷达配套数据处理软件Pavecheck对数据进行导出;
S6、数据格式转换:对导出的数据进行格式转换,转换为MATLAB中三维成像模型能够识别的Excel格式数据;
S7、三维反射电压数据模拟:目前采集到的单车道测线为3条,将两条测线间的数据进行线性扩充模拟,每两条测线间的数据扩充4组,提高其分辨率;
S8、颜设定:对最大及最小值的颜进行设定;
突然间的自我S9、数据导入:使用MATLAB的Excel数据导入功能,将三维数据导入三维成像模型,得到三维成像;
S10、异常显示:三维成像后,对异常位置进行切片化显示,直观地显示出道路深层病害。
2.根据权利要求1所述的基于MATLAB的二维探地雷达三维成像方法,其特征在于,步骤S2的具体方法为:
i、确定行驶线路:确认雷达车行驶路线与速度,数据采集路线为每条车道在左、右轮迹带及道路中间各采集一次,即每条车道采集三次,其中,采集左、右轮迹带数据时,将雷达车的左、右轮轧在左、右两侧的车道分隔线上,将车速控制在15km/h;
ii、雷达设备组装:包括基座安装、天线梁安装、电脑桌安装、雷达安装、GPS和摄像头安装;
iii、检查线路:仔细检查一遍所有的电源线路后,打开三菱车蓄电池电源,检查摄像头、GPS和雷达是否通电;
iv、标定:探地雷达在数据收集前预热至少15分钟,并收集一个金属板的雷达反射波,在探地雷达数据收集结束后,探地雷达已经完全预热并且信号稳定;
v、数据采集:按照既定路线进行数据采集,让雷达车直线行驶,让雷达车在采集左轮迹带时,将左轮轧在车道左标线上;相反,在采集右轮迹带时,将右轮轧在车道右标线上,且雷达车行驶速度不得超过15km/h,数据文件标明路段与时间,确认后不能再作更改;
vi、数据检查:采集结束后使用Pavecheck软件尝试将6趟采集的数据全部打开,以确认所有文件无损可用。
3.根据权利要求1所述的基于MATLAB的二维探地雷达三维成像方法,其特征在于,步骤S3的具体方法为:
在MATLAB中建立用于存储三维数据的三维矩阵:
烟草专卖品准运证管理办法设置x方向上的网格数量:x=0:1:1999;
设置y方向上的网格数量:y=0:1:25;
设置z方向上的网格数量:z=0:1:119;
生成超立方体定义域中的数据点矩阵:[X,Y,Z]=meshgrid(x,y,z);
设置用于储存三维数据的三维矩阵c:c=X。
4.根据权利要求1所述的基于MATLAB的二维探地雷达三维成像方法,其特征在于,步骤S4的具体方法为:
对模型的外观进行优化处理,进行彩插值处理,使彩平滑过渡以及去掉边框颜线;
使用MATLAB自带的图形处理器进行模型的尺寸调整,使其符合道路外形。
在或不在
5.根据权利要求1所述的基于MATLAB的二维探地雷达三维成像方法,其特征在于,步骤S5的具体方法为:
通过二维探地雷达配套数据处理软件Pavecheck自带的数据导出功能;Output Format选择Horizontal Listed;Date Type中的选择项为Voltage和12bit Binary,二者数据可以互相转换;导出方式选择By trace number。
6.根据权利要求1所述的基于MATLAB的二维探地雷达三维成像方法,其特征在于,步骤S6的具体方法为:
导出的数据文件格式为TXT格式,将其转换为MATLAB模型读取的Excel格式数据,并调整其数据大小满足模型要求,具体操作步骤如下:
i、新建Microsoft Excel文件,选择“数据”选项,然后选择“自文本”选项,导入反射电压原始数据TXT文件;
ii、由于导出数据排列顺序是依照每个Trace的大小将所有组数据依次排列,而每组数据又包含多个数据,依据电压反射顺序从上至下依次排列,经测算,每组的多个数据中,从路面往下的为有效数据,删除路面以上的数据;
iii、为了模拟实际道路,满足水平方向×垂直方向的数据形式,将所有的数据进行转置。
7.根据权利要求1所述的基于MATLAB的二维探地雷达三维成像方法,其特征在于,步骤S8的具体方法为:
数据全部导入完成后,保存数据矩阵,根据所有数据的值的大小,调出ColormapEditor窗口,对最大及最小值的颜进行设定,调整所有数据,使其大小均在0~1之间;为模拟原雷达图像,将最大值1设定为蓝,0.6406设定为绿,0.4062设定为黄,0.1875设定为红,最小值0设定为粉红。混合器
8.根据权利要求1所述的基于MATLAB的二维探地雷达三维成像方法,其特征在于,步骤S10的具体方
法为:
三维成像后,对异常位置进行切片化显示,直观地显示出道路深层病害,通过MATLAB对数据的NaN功能实现;对数据的NaN功能即是将要切下的部分数据将其设定为NaN,使其为“空”。
技术说明书
一种基于MATLAB的二维探地雷达三维成像方法
技术领域
本技术涉及道路工程领域,尤其涉及一种基于MATLAB的二维探地雷达三维成像方法。
背景技术
探地雷达三维成像技术应用于对浅地表的探测中时展示出了巨大的优势与潜力,它不仅可以提供清晰的浅层三维图像,更让地球物理学家们的相关研究有了更直观的参考依据。应用于道路工程对路面探测也是如此,探地雷达三维成像的概念最开始是是由Grasmueck等在2005年提出,其研究主要是针对当时一般的商用探地雷达系统所采用的天线共置测量方式,但其与SAR成像技术中所提的高分辨成像并不相同,探地雷达中的高分辨率是指无混叠的三维数据采集以保证路面复杂目标三维成像结果的真实性与可靠性。
探地雷达三维成像最首要的一步就是获取三维数据,目前国外较主流的获取三维数据的方式为使用3D-GPR系统。该系统能够在移动中采集三维雷达数据并记录坐标,另外它也自带一套数据处理软件,能够对三维数据进行切片形式的可视化处理。
而国内自行研发生产的三维雷达不多见,大多都引进国外的设备,比如山东公路局从3D-Radar公司引进的三维探地雷达,以及中国煤炭地质局引进的 16道阵列天线的三维探地雷达等。国内自行研制最新的三维探地雷达是国防科学技术大学在国家“863”计划项目的资助下,研发的一套名为RadarEye的冲激脉冲体制三维探地雷达系统。
综上,三维雷达相关研究发展较快的是日本、英国、美国等最早开始研究探地雷达的国家,国内相关研究较少,我国鲜有三维雷达数据采集的设备,且在这些设备中绝大多数依靠的是进口,因此大多数正在服役的探地雷达均为二维,但道路本身是一个三维立体结构,那么其病害的存在形式也必然是三维的,二维雷达无法检测到病害全貌,而引进三维雷达所耗费的资金庞大,因此使用二维雷达获取三维数据成像将能很好地解决这一问题。另外,一个通用的三维数据成像方法,将能满足各种可导出数据的二维雷达实现三维检测功能。
技术内容
本技术要解决的技术问题在于针对现有技术中的缺陷,提供一种基于 MATLAB的二维探地雷达三维成
像方法。能实现使用二维雷达进行三维检测的功能。而对于其他型号的探地雷达包括三维探地雷达,只需获悉其数据存储格式,获取数据后修改模型大小,即可利用此模型进行三维成像,代码简单,可根据需要进行切片化显示,使三维图像内部可见。
本技术解决其技术问题所采用的技术方案是:
本技术提供一种基于MATLAB的二维探地雷达三维成像方法,该方法包括以下步骤:
S1、准备工作:对二维探地雷达进行组装和调试,将其安装在雷达车上,确认进行数据采集的路段和采集时间,并制定数据采集计划;
S2、数据采集:通过雷达车按照采集计划中的采集路线,对采集路线中的各条车道进行数据采集,为让雷达车按直线行驶,在采集左轮迹带时,将左轮轧在车道左标线上;在采集右轮迹带时,将右轮轧在车道右标线上;通过二维探地雷达配套数据处理软件Pavecheck对数据进行数据完整性检查;
S3、三维成像模型建立:通过生成超立方体定义域中的数据点矩阵的方法,在MATLAB中建立用于存储三维数据的三维矩阵,作为三维成像模型;S4、模型优化:对三维成像模型进行外观优化和尺寸调整,使其符合道路外形;
S5、三维数据导出:通过二维探地雷达配套数据处理软件Pavecheck对数据进行导出;
S6、数据格式转换:对导出的数据进行格式转换,转换为MATLAB中三维成像模型能够识别的Excel格式数据;
S7、三维反射电压数据模拟:目前采集到的单车道测线为3条,将两条测线间的数据进行线性扩充模拟,每两条测线间的数据扩充4组,提高其分辨率;
S8、颜设定:对最大及最小值的颜进行设定;
S9、数据导入:使用MATLAB的Excel数据导入功能,将三维数据导入三维成像模型,得到三维成像;
S10、异常显示:三维成像后,对异常位置进行切片化显示,直观地显示出道路深层病害。
进一步地,本技术的步骤S2的具体方法为:
去年的树教学实录i、确定行驶线路:确认雷达车行驶路线与速度,数据采集路线为每条车道在左、右轮迹带及道路中间各采集一次,即每条车道采集三次,其中,采集左、右轮迹带数据时,将雷达车的左、右轮轧在左、右两侧的车道分隔线上,将车速控制在15km/h;
ii、雷达设备组装:包括基座安装、天线梁安装、电脑桌安装、雷达安装、 GPS和摄像头安装;
iii、检查线路:仔细检查一遍所有的电源线路后,打开三菱车蓄电池电源,检查摄像头、GPS和雷达是否通电;
iv、标定:探地雷达在数据收集前预热至少15分钟,并收集一个金属板的雷达反射波,在探地雷达数据收集结束后,探地雷达已经完全预热并且信号稳定;
v、数据采集:按照既定路线进行数据采集,让雷达车直线行驶,让雷达车在采集左轮迹带时,将左轮轧在车道左标线上;相反,在采集右轮迹带时,将右轮轧在车道右标线上,且雷达车行驶速度不得超过15km/h,数据文件标明路段与时间,确认后不能再作更改;
vi、数据检查:采集结束后使用Pavecheck软件尝试将6趟采集的数据全部打开,以确认所有文件无损可用。
进一步地,本技术的步骤S3的具体方法为:
在MATLAB中建立用于存储三维数据的三维矩阵:
设置x方向上的网格数量:x=0:1:1999;
设置y方向上的网格数量:y=0:1:25;
设置z方向上的网格数量:z=0:1:119;
生成超立方体定义域中的数据点矩阵:[X,Y,Z]=meshgrid(x,y,z);
设置用于储存三维数据的三维矩阵c:c=X。
进一步地,本技术的步骤S4的具体方法为:
对模型的外观进行优化处理,进行彩插值处理,使彩平滑过渡以及去掉边框颜线;
使用MATLAB自带的图形处理器进行模型的尺寸调整,使其符合道路外形。
进一步地,本技术的步骤S5的具体方法为:
通过二维探地雷达配套数据处理软件Pavecheck自带的数据导出功能; OutputFormat选择Horizontal Listed;Date Type中的选择项为Voltage和12bit Binary,二者数据可以互相转换;导出方式选择By trace number。
进一步地,本技术的步骤S6的具体方法为:
导出的数据文件格式为TXT格式,将其转换为MATLAB模型读取的Excel 格式数据,并调整其数据大小
满足模型要求,具体操作步骤如下:
i、新建Microsoft Excel文件,选择“数据”选项,然后选择“自文本”选项,导入反射电压原始数据TXT文件;
ii、由于导出数据排列顺序是依照每个Trace的大小将所有组数据依次排列,而每组数据又包含多个数据,依据电压反射顺序从上至下依次排列,经测算,每组的多个数据中,从路面往下的为有效数据,删除路面以上的数据;一氧化二氢是什么
iii、为了模拟实际道路,满足水平方向×垂直方向的数据形式,将所有的数据进行转置。
进一步地,本技术的步骤S8的具体方法为:
数据全部导入完成后,保存数据矩阵,根据所有数据的值的大小,调出 ColormapEditor窗口,对最大及最小值的颜进行设定,调整所有数据,使其大小均在0~1之间;为模拟原雷达图像,将最大值1设定为蓝,0.6406设定为绿,0.4062设定为黄,0.1875设定为红,最小值0设定为粉红。
进一步地,本技术的步骤S10的具体方法为:
三维成像后,对异常位置进行切片化显示,直观地显示出道路深层病害,通过MATLAB对数据的NaN功能实现;对数据的NaN功能即是将要切下的部分数据将其设定为NaN,使其为“空”。
本技术产生的有益效果是:本技术的基于MATLAB的二维探地雷达三维成像方法通过数据采集与处理,模拟形成探地雷达三维成像数据,接着利用MATLAB的成像功能,通过三维模型的建立与优化,形成能够容纳三维雷达数据的成像模型,在将模拟的三维数据导入后,实现三维雷达成像,并具备图像切割功能,以便观察道路内部异常图像。该方法实现了利用二维雷达进行三维检测的目的,对于其他型号的探地雷达包括三维探地雷达,

本文发布于:2024-09-23 04:34:41,感谢您对本站的认可!

本文链接:https://www.17tex.com/xueshu/33415.html

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系,我们将在24小时内删除。

标签:数据   进行   采集   探地   成像   模型   技术   道路
留言与评论(共有 0 条评论)
   
验证码:
Copyright ©2019-2024 Comsenz Inc.Powered by © 易纺专利技术学习网 豫ICP备2022007602号 豫公网安备41160202000603 站长QQ:729038198 关于我们 投诉建议